[Previous Event]: Beirut Fly-in: Disaster relief fundraiser (Sat 22nd Aug)

As many of you may have seen Beirut was rocked by a terrible explosion on 4th August that (as of writing) killed 171, injured more 5,000 and has left potentially 300,000 people homeless.

How is this related to MSFS you may ask? With the release we can now go anywhere in the world – it is only through previously flying to Beirut Intl Airport (OLBA) in Flight Simulators before that I am familiar with Beirut and have seen how close this massive explosion was to many buildings and people’s homes.

Everyone is invited to the Beirut fly-in and this will be casual event. If possible, donate to one of the many charities supporting people on the ground. If you are unable to donate, that’s not a problem - you can still join in and enjoy the scenic views!

When: 2020-08-22T14:00:00Z

Depart: LCLK - Larnaca International Airport, Cyprus
Arrive: OLBA – Beirut–Rafic Hariri International Airport

Flight Plan:

  • Spawn at one of the parking spots at LCLK
  • Line-up together on LCLK RW4, depart 2020-08-22T14:00:00Z
  • After take-off, right turn heading 120
  • Climb 10,000 ft
  • Cruise speed: 200 kt

Aircraft: Any, however recommend something capable of 200kts e.g TBM
